Transaction 3259780defed0a851ffeb6b2fb9bd55bb7127590bc5841cc3f794575c92adf81

1 Input
2 Outputs
  • 3259780defed0a851ffeb6b2fb9bd55bb7127590bc5841cc3f794575c92adf81:0
  • value  151468
    address  3BbsNJhD8jNaDTnC5SwehzSzB2pVoRTqMM
  • 3259780defed0a851ffeb6b2fb9bd55bb7127590bc5841cc3f794575c92adf81:1
  • value  27968
    address  37a5Cpn2puNxo6rVDz325v6tvPXC1Kcaor